Bama spending money trying to find someone to coach up the DL.

Kuligowski was out of football this season after being fired by the Crimson Tide following his first year with the team.

LINK


Despite not working for Alabama this season, Kuligowski was paid $933,793 by Alabama in 2019, according to the university’s financial database. Kuligowski, who was owed the money for the second year of his two-year, $750,000 per year contract, was paid an average of $62,530 per month as well as two one-time payments of $120,000 and $63,433.
